以太坊钱包与账户的关系分析:深入理解区块链

### 内容主体大纲 1. 引言 - 以太坊的背景 - 钱包与账户的重要性 2. 以太坊账户的类型 - 外部账户(EOA) - 合约账户 3. 以太坊钱包的概念 - 如何工作 - 钱包的类型 4. 钱包与账户的关系 - 钱包是账户的载体 - 钱包的私钥和公钥 5. 钱包的安全性 - 安全性挑战 - 常见安全措施 6. 如何选择合适的以太坊钱包 - 不同用户需求 - 钱包的兼容性 7. 常见问题解答 - 钱包与账户管理的误区 - 未来发展趋势 8. 总结 - 钱包与账户相辅相成 - 提高用户的安全意识 ### 详细内容 #### 引言

以太坊是当前区块链技术中的核心之一,它为智能合约和去中心化应用提供了基础设施。随着越来越多的人进入区块链领域,理解以太坊的各种概念显得尤为重要。其中,以太坊的钱包与账户是不可或缺的组成部分,直接关系到用户资产的管理与安全。

在这篇文章中,我们将深入探讨以太坊钱包和账户的关系。首先,我们会介绍以太坊账户的不同类型,然后探讨以太坊钱包的概念及其工作原理,接着分析钱包与账户之间的关系,最后讨论安全性以及如何选择合适的钱包。

#### 以太坊账户的类型

外部账户(EOA)

在以太坊中,外部账户(Externally Owned Account,EOA)是由用户控制的账户,通过私钥来管理。每个EOA都有对应的公钥和地址,用户可以使用这些信息进行交易,存储以太坊(ETH)和代币。

EOA通常用于发送和接收ETH或代币操作,它们的私钥由用户自行管理,若私钥丢失,则无法恢复账户。所以,保持私钥的安全至关重要。

合约账户

合约账户属于智能合约的范畴,这类账户并非由用户控制,而是自动执行预设条件的合约代码。合约账户也有地址,可以接收ETH和代币,但其操作往往是被动的,只会在特定条件达成时被激活。

合约账户的复杂性在于,它们通常需要编写合约代码,因此对于一般用户来说管理和理解起来相对困难。但合约账户为应用开发者提供了强大的功能,可以实现复杂的交易和服务。

#### 以太坊钱包的概念

如何工作

以太坊钱包并不直接存储以太坊或代币,而是保管用户的私钥,与账户相对应。当用户进行交易时,钱包会使用私钥对交易进行签名,确保安全性。

以太坊支持多种类型的钱包,包括硬件钱包、软件钱包和在线钱包。硬件钱包最为安全,适合长期存储资产;软件钱包则便于日常使用;在线钱包提供了方便的访问方式,适合移动设备使用。

钱包的类型

常见的以太坊钱包包括:
1. **硬件钱包**:如Ledger Nano S,安全性高,适合长期持有和大额交易。
2. **软件钱包**:包括桌面钱包(如Mist)、移动钱包(如Trust Wallet)、扩展钱包(如MetaMask),具备易用性和灵活性。
3. **在线钱包**:如Coinbase钱包、Binance钱包,便于快速交易但相对安全性较低。

#### 钱包与账户的关系

钱包是账户的载体

以太坊的钱包和账户之间的主要关系是:钱包负责存储账户的私钥,而账户则是用户在以太坊网络上的身份。用户通过钱包管理其账户中的资产。

每个以太坊账户都有独特的地址,与钱包生成的公钥相关联。用户可以利用钱包提供的接口轻松地进行转账、查看余额等操作,而无需直接操作区块链。

钱包的私钥和公钥

在以太坊中,私钥和公钥的安全性是用户资产安全的关键。钱包存储的私钥是用来对交易进行签名的重要凭据。如果私钥被他人获取,恶意用户可以完全控制账户。因此,用户应将私钥妥善保管,忌讳随意分享。

公钥与地址可以公开分享,用户通过这些信息接收资金而无需担心安全性。然而,随着越来越多的用户进入这个生态系统,教育用户关于私钥和公钥的重要性成为了一个必要的任务。

#### 钱包的安全性

安全性挑战

以太坊的安全性面临多种挑战,包括黑客攻击、钓鱼诈骗、钱包软件漏洞等。用户在选择和使用钱包时,需要警惕这些风险,采取相应措施来保护资产。

例如,许多用户倾向于在在线钱包中存储自己的资产,给黑客提供了攻击入口。硬件钱包虽然价格较高,但提供了更为安全的存储选项,用户在存储大额资产时应优先考虑。

常见安全措施

用户可以通过多种方式提升账户的安全性,例如:
1. **使用硬件钱包**:硬件钱包将私钥存储在设备中,防止在线攻击。
2. **启用双重身份验证**:在登录钱包时,启用双重身份验证可增加账户安全性。
3. **定期更新软件**:保持钱包软件的更新,防止软件漏洞被利用。
4. **谨防钓鱼**:在输入私钥或密码前,确保网站的合法性以避免钓鱼攻击。

#### 如何选择合适的以太坊钱包

不同用户需求

选择合适的以太坊钱包,需要根据个人的使用需求进行评估。如果是日常交易,移动钱包或在线钱包提供了很大的便利性;而如果是长期持有,硬件钱包则更为安全。

根据个人经验和资产规模,可以根据风险容忍度选择不同级别的钱包。小额资产可以考虑软件钱包,而大额资产还是建议使用硬件钱包。

钱包的兼容性

选择钱包时需考虑其兼容性,不同钱包对于ERC-20代币的支持不同。确保所选钱包能够存储你计划投资的代币,这样可以避免未来的操作不便。

一些流行的钱包同时支持多种区块链,如以太坊和比特币,让用户可以在同一平台下管理不同的资产。此种化的管理方式无疑会提升用户的使用体验。

#### 常见问题解答

钱包与账户管理的误区

常见的误区在于认为钱存在钱包中,实际上,钱包只管理私钥与相关信息;资产存在区块链上,每个账户的小额变化只有在进行操作时才会呈现。理解这一点可以帮助用户更好地管理自己的资产。

此外,许多用户也误认为只要有钱包就能保证安全。钱包的安全性依赖于用户的操作习惯和私钥的管理,因此教育用户识别安全性是至关重要的。

未来发展趋势

随着区块链技术的不断发展,钱包与账户之间的关系也将趋向于简化与,更多用户将会利用去中心化钱包进行资产管理。同时,合约账户的智能合约化运作将进一步丰富以太坊的功能性。

安全性将在未来成为一个重要的研究方向,如何将用户体验与安全性兼顾将是钱包开发者面临的一大挑战。未来的以太坊钱包有望在数据安全、用户友好性与多功能性等方面取得平衡。

#### 总结

通过以上分析,我们可以清楚地看到,以太坊钱包与账户的关系是相辅相成的。钱包负责存储账户的私钥,账户则是在以太坊网络上进行操作的身份。用户在管理资产的时候,务必要理解这一关系并采取相应的安全措施。

随着技术的发展,用户需要保持对区块链技术的持续学习,不断提升自身的安全意识,从而更好的保障自己的数字资产安全。